Accessing Moline Police Arrest Records

The Moline Law Enforcement Department maintains records of detentions and unlawful actions within the city. To access these records, you will typically need to file the public records request under the Illinois Access to Public Records Act. This request can often be submitted via postal service, in person, or sometimes through an online platform, depending on the department’s current methods. It’s advised to contact the department directly at 309-797-0401 or via website for the most accurate and up-to-date details regarding this process.

Moline Police Jail Roster and Inmate Location

The Moline Law Enforcement Agency maintains a inmate roster for individuals who have been taken into custody and are currently held in the city jail. To locate detainees in their custody, you would typically need to contact the department directly at 309-797-0401 or use any available online resources they provide on the website. It’s important to remember that details such as the prisoner’s full name, date of birth, or booking number might be required for this process.
